Former Labor minister arrested weeks after release

Paedophile former politician Milton Orkopoulos is back in hot water because he allegedly can’t keep his hand off a phone.

Orkopoulos, 62, was arrested just after 7am today and has been charged at Maroubra Police Station with three counts of failing to comply with reporting conditions.

The former NSW Labor minister was refused police bail and his matter was briefly mentioned in Waverley Local Court today but he did not appear on audio visual link.

His defence asked for the matter to be adjourned for one day, at which point he would apply for bail.

Magistrate Michael Crompton adjourned the matter.

Court documents say that Orkopoulos is accused of failing to comply with reporting obligations while in Malabar between February 5 and February 11.

The State Parole Authority said it is waiting for a breach report from Community Corrections NSW before taking further action concerning Milton Orkopoulos.

The SPA was told this morning that he had been arrested.

“Following today’s developments it is expected a new breach report may be submitted to the SPA,” a spokeswoman said.

Orkopoulos was released on parole on December 20 after more than a decade behind bars for 30 child sexual abuse and drugs charges and placed on the Child Protection Register.

He was charged by police just a month later for allegedly breaching the conditions of the CPR by setting up an Instagram account to follow soccer superstar Cristiano Ronaldo and not telling police within the required seven days. He also was accused of using the phone to speak to a child relative.

In Waverley Local Court, his lawyer, Omar Juweinat, entered formal not guilty pleas on his behalf and the case was adjourned to next month.

This time it is alleged that he has breached his CPR conditions by using someone else’s phone that has internet access.
